Sheltering Grace Ministry, Ltd. is a 501(c)3 nonprofit ministry headquartered in Marietta, GA that was founded in response to the alarming number of homeless pregnant women in the Atlanta Metro area.
Our goal is to #breakthecycle that leads to homelessness and its resulting effects.
